2010-11-11 73 views
0

是否有可能使用Adorner或其他方式動態獲取UIElement/FrameworkElement並將其置於動態創建的ScrollViwer?我知道,顯而易見的問題是,你必須首先從它的父元素中分離元素,但我正在尋找一個這樣做的優雅方式。將ScrollViewer附加到FrameworkElement?

回答

0

如果你的元素不必是交互式的,你可以使用VisualBrush。如果它必須從一個地方移動到另一個地方並繼續照常工作,則必須重複控制或附加/分離控制。

據我所知,有這樣的沒有「優雅」的方式 - 你必須要經過正常的手段,比如Children.Remove/Add(如果其父是面板)等